Output 90fa6b82123475fe73502e0a6813d77458b7f0c783820228d24415eb0a09b9f9:0

value
884700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e004da95fc275c55519236180ba70557a7761a85 OP_EQUAL
address
3N7X6mLZsjK1qAsgmBKwp1wM1rVAP1HdX4
transaction
90fa6b82123475fe73502e0a6813d77458b7f0c783820228d24415eb0a09b9f9
confirmations
299503
spent
true